华为云服务器什么虚拟化构架

worktile 其他 99

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    华为云服务器采用的是基于KVM(Kernel-based Virtual Machine)的虚拟化架构。

    KVM 是一种开源的虚拟化解决方案,由于其高性能和稳定性,成为了目前主流的虚拟化技术之一。KVM 基于 Linux 内核,可以将物理服务器分割成多个虚拟机,每个虚拟机都可以独立运行不同的操作系统和应用程序。

    华为云服务器的虚拟化构架基于 KVM,因此具有以下特点:

    1. 功能丰富:KVM 提供了完整的虚拟化功能,支持热迁移、快照、动态资源调整等高级特性,为用户提供了灵活的虚拟化环境。

    2. 高性能:KVM 直接在硬件层面进行虚拟化,减少了性能开销,并且支持硬件辅助虚拟化,如 Intel VT 和 AMD SVM,提供了更好的性能和安全性。

    3. 安全可靠:KVM 利用 Linux 内核的安全机制,实现了虚拟机的隔离和安全性,可以保护用户数据的安全。同时,KVM 还支持虚拟机的快照和迁移,保证了数据的可靠性和高可用性。

    4. 多租户支持:KVM 提供了完善的多租户隔离机制,可以将不同用户的虚拟机进行隔离,确保用户之间的互不干扰。

    总而言之,华为云服务器采用基于 KVM 的虚拟化构架,具有丰富的功能、高性能、安全可靠和多租户支持的特点,为用户提供了稳定、灵活的虚拟化环境。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    华为云服务器采用的虚拟化构架是基于KVM(Kernel-based Virtual Machine)的。以下是关于华为云服务器虚拟化构架的五个特点:

    1. KVM虚拟化技术:KVM是Linux内核模块,基于硬件虚拟化扩展的全虚拟化技术。它通过将物理服务器分割成多个虚拟机,每个虚拟机独立运行自己的操作系统和应用程序,并能够直接访问硬件资源。KVM提供了高性能和安全性,是华为云服务器实现虚拟化的核心技术。

    2. 弹性资源配置:华为云服务器提供弹性资源配置功能,可以根据用户的需求调整虚拟机的计算、存储和网络资源。用户可以根据工作负载的变化自由调整虚拟机的规格,以满足不同应用的要求。

    3. 高可用性:华为云服务器采用冷备份和快速迁移技术,保证了虚拟机的高可用性。当物理服务器发生故障时,冷备份技术可以快速将虚拟机从故障服务器迁移到备用服务器,实现了快速恢复;而快速迁移技术可以在不停机的情况下将虚拟机迁移到其他物理服务器,保证了用户的业务不中断。

    4. 虚拟化加速技术:华为云服务器还采用了虚拟化加速技术,包括物理机直通、SR-IOV等。物理机直通技术可以将部分硬件资源直接分配给虚拟机,从而提高虚拟机的性能和扩展性;SR-IOV技术可以将虚拟机直接与物理网卡相连,实现了更低的延迟和更高的吞吐量。

    5. 安全性:华为云服务器提供多层次的安全保护措施,包括硬件安全、软件安全和网络安全。硬件安全方面,采用了可信计算技术和安全启动技术,确保了物理服务器的安全可信。软件安全方面,采用了安全隔离、访问控制和数据加密等技术,保护虚拟机和应用程序的安全。网络安全方面,提供了DDoS防护、网络隔离、安全组等功能,保护用户的网络环境免受攻击。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    华为云服务器使用的虚拟化架构是KVM虚拟化。KVM(Kernel-based Virtual Machine)是基于Linux内核的虚拟化技术,通过将Linux内核作为第一层,在其上实现虚拟化管理功能。

    下面将从方法、操作流程等方面详细讲解华为云服务器的KVM虚拟化构架。

    1. 虚拟机管理器(Hypervisor)
    虚拟机管理器是KVM虚拟化的核心组件,它直接集成到Linux内核中。常见的虚拟机管理器有两种类型:Type 1(裸机虚拟化)和Type 2(宿主机虚拟化)。

    • Type 1虚拟化:Hypervisor直接运行在物理服务器硬件上,可以更加高效地实现虚拟机的创建、管理和运行。华为云服务器使用Type 1虚拟化,确保性能和稳定性。
    • Type 2虚拟化:Hypervisor运行在操作系统上,透过操作系统与硬件的交互来实现虚拟化。在Type 2虚拟化中,由于多了一层操作系统,性能会有所损失。

    2. 虚拟机(Virtual Machine)的创建和管理
    在华为云服务器上,可以通过Web控制台、命令行工具或API等多种方式创建和管理虚拟机。

    • 创建虚拟机:首先选择虚拟机规格,包括CPU、内存、存储等配置,然后选择操作系统模板,最后设置网络和安全组等相关参数。虚拟机创建完成后,可以获取到虚拟机的IP地址和登录密码,用于远程登录和管理。
    • 管理虚拟机:可以通过Web控制台或命令行工具对虚拟机进行管理,包括查看虚拟机的状态、启动、停止、重启、扩容等操作。

    3. 存储虚拟化
    在KVM虚拟化中,存储虚拟化是一个重要的组件。华为云服务器提供了多种存储类型供用户选择,包括本地磁盘、分布式存储、块存储和文件存储等。

    • 本地磁盘:使用物理服务器上的本地磁盘作为存储介质,性能较高,但容量相对有限。
    • 分布式存储:将多台物理服务器上的磁盘组合成一个存储池,提供高性能和高可用性的存储服务。
    • 块存储:将存储分割为一块块的存储单元,并以块的形式提供给虚拟机使用,提供了更高的灵活性和可扩展性。
    • 文件存储:将存储以文件的形式提供给虚拟机使用,适用于需要频繁备份和恢复的场景。

    4. 虚拟网络的构建
    在KVM虚拟化中,虚拟网络是用于虚拟机之间和虚拟机与物理网络之间通信的关键组件。华为云服务器提供了灵活的网络配置,用户可以根据需求创建和管理虚拟网络。

    • 虚拟交换机:通过虚拟交换机可以将多个虚拟机连接在同一个网络中,实现虚拟机之间的通信。
    • 虚拟路由器:虚拟路由器可以实现虚拟机和物理网络之间的通信,同时还支持路由策略和网络安全等功能。
    • IP地址管理:华为云服务器提供了IP地址池和弹性IP等功能,可以实现IP地址的动态分配和管理,方便用户进行网络配置。

    5. 安全和监控
    华为云服务器提供了多种安全和监控功能,保障用户数据的安全和可靠性。

    • 防火墙:可以通过配置网络安全组和防火墙规则,限制进出虚拟机的网络流量,提高网络安全性。
    • 监控和告警:通过监控功能可以实时监控虚拟机的资源使用情况,包括CPU、内存、网络和存储等。同时还可以设置告警规则,及时发现和处理异常情况。

    总结:华为云服务器使用的虚拟化架构是KVM虚拟化。KVM虚拟化通过在Linux内核上运行虚拟机管理器,实现了虚拟机的创建、管理和运行。华为云服务器提供了多种功能和选项,包括虚拟机、存储、网络、安全和监控等,满足了用户的不同需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部